/*****************返回值都是最前面呼叫這個方法的元素 ***************** */
//這是外部插入
$("div").insertbefore($("span")); //把div插在span的前面,返回值是 $("div")
$("div").before($("span")); //div的前面是span(span在div前面),返回值是 $("div")
$("div").insertafter($("span")); //把div插在span的後面,返回值是 $("div")
$("div").after($("span")); //div的後面是span(span在div後面),返回值是 $("div")
//這是內部插入
$("div").prependto($("span")); //把div追加到span內部的前面
$("div").prepend($("span")); //div內部的前面是span
jQuery內部插入和外部插入
不管是內部插入還是外部插入 都分為前面插入跟後面插入 這是什麼虎狼之辭 說正經的 在內部末尾新增 在內部開頭新增 prepend 是對匹配到的物件元素進行內容的追加 書寫格式是 box prepend abcd box 是匹配的物件元素 abcd 是追加的內容 簡單說就是在 box裡的開頭新增abc...
DOM節點的插入
動態建立的元素是不夠的,它只是臨時存放在記憶體中,最終我們需要放到頁面文件並呈現出來。那麼問題來了,怎麼放到文件上?這裡就涉及到乙個位置關係,常見的就是把這個新建立的元素,當作頁面某乙個元素的子元素放到其內部。針對這樣的處理,jquery就定義2個操作的方法 簡單的總結就是 2 dom外部插入aft...
建立和插入DOM節點
插入節點 我們獲得了某個dom節點,假設這個dom節點是空的,我們通過innerhtml就可以增加乙個元素了,但是這個dom節點已經存在元素了,我們就不能這麼幹了 會產生覆蓋 追加j ascript j ase j aee j ame 效果 建立乙個新的標籤,實現插入 insertbefore le...